A Canvas When Off, A Cinema When On
The Gallery TV distinguishes itself with a focus on aesthetic versatility. When not actively displaying your favorite shows or movies, it transforms into a dynamic art display. here’s a breakdown of its key features:
* Flush-Mount Design: It sits nearly flat against your wall, creating a clean and sophisticated look.
* Magnetic Frames: Customizable frames allow you to tailor the TV’s appearance to your personal style.
* Art Mode: Display a curated selection of artwork when the TV is idle, turning your living room into a personal gallery.
Premium Entertainment Experience
Beyond its artistic capabilities, the Gallery TV delivers a top-tier viewing experience. It’s packed with advanced technology to ensure exceptional picture and sound quality.
* MiniLED Technology: expect vibrant colors, deep blacks, and amazing contrast.
* α (Alpha) 7 AI Processor: This powerful processor optimizes picture and sound for immersive viewing.
* AI Sound Pro (Virtual 9.1.2ch): enjoy a cinematic audio experience with virtual surround sound.
* Internal Memory: Ample storage allows you to store and curate your favorite content directly on the TV.
LG Gallery+ – A World of Visuals at Your fingertips
LG elevates the art experience with its Gallery+ service. This extensive platform provides access to a constantly updated library of visuals.
* Extensive Library: Over 4,500 works are available, refreshed monthly.
* Diverse Content: Explore fine art, cinematic scenes, game visuals, and animations.
* Personalized decor: Easily match the displayed artwork to your mood and interior design.
Availability and First Look
LG will be showcasing the Gallery TV at CES 2026 next week. Available in 55- and 65-inch models, pricing and a firm release date are still to be announced. This new TV promises to be a significant addition to the lifestyle TV market, offering a unique combination of aesthetics and performance.
